Wedding Cake Trends for 2026: Art, Elegance, and Personalization

Wedding cakes have always been the centerpiece of celebration, but in 2026 they’re evolving into something even more magical: edible works of art and interactive guest experiences. Couples are moving beyond traditional tiers and exploring creative, personalized styles that make their cakes a reflection of their story.

1. Vintage Cakes with a Modern Twist
The vintage cake has officially made its comeback, and this time, it’s here to stay. Think classic piped details, lace-like frosting, pastel hues, and elegant pearls. These cakes nod to the sophistication of the past while pairing beautifully with today’s luxury wedding décor.

2. Rectangular Minimalist Cakes
A bold shift from the round tiered cake, rectangular cakes are making a chic statement. Their clean lines are accented with floral or fruit details, creating a sleek and modern look with a hint of softness. Perfect for couples who love contemporary design and understated elegance.


3. The Italian Vintage Interactive Cake
One of the most exciting trends for 2026 is the interactive cake experience. Inspired by Italian traditions, couples dress their cake at the reception with fresh berries, powdered sugar, or toppings in front of their guests. Whether it’s the couple or the baker his moment becomes a fun, Instagram-worthy highlight that gets everyone talking.
4. Sculptural Cakes as Edible Art
Cakes are no longer just desserts, they’re sculptures. From abstract designs to floral-inspired shapes, couples are commissioning cakes that feel like modern art installations. These statement cakes are conversation pieces that wow guests visually before delighting them with flavor.
5. Dessert Cakes Beyond Cake
Not all couples want traditional cake in 2026. Some are opting for their favorite desserts like tiramisu, cheesecake, or even stacked pastries dressed up to look like a wedding cake. Guests not only enjoy watching the presentation but also savor something unexpected that reflects the couple’s personal taste.
